摘要
This study goes along the previous study of Bernardes and Zhou (2013), namely "On the heat storage in Solar Updraft Tower collectors Water Bags" analysing especially the sensible heat storage physical process in a Solar Updraft Tower collector taking into account the transient heat transfer in some typical soils through conduction, convection and solar radiation. For that, the mathematical model implemented in the earlier work was adapted to investigate the influence of thermal diffusivity and effusivity for some ground thermal properties. These simulations disclosed a complex ground thermal behaviour for different soil materials revealing that materials with lower thermal effusivity and diffusivity can decrease substantially output peaks for periods with greater heat gains.
